Author: bskeggs
Update of /cvs/pkgs/rpms/libdrm/F-11
In directory cvs1.fedora.phx.redhat.com:/tmp/cvs-serv4544
Modified Files:
libdrm.spec nouveau-updates.patch
Log Message:
* Fri Apr 17 2009 Ben Skeggs <bskeggs at redhat.com> 2.4.6-6
- nouveau: post writes to pushbuf before incrementing PUT
